Higher Danger of Death and Hospitalization With Digoxin

Digoxin, a common drug used for heart condition treatments, is found associated with 71 percent greater risk of death and 63 percent greater risk of hospitalization among adults with diagnosed atrial fibrillation and no evidence of heart failure. This is according to a Kaiser Permanente study that appears in the current online issue of emCirculation: Arrhythmia and Electrophysiology/em.
